Ireland miss World Cup auto-qualify as France beat dem 1-0 for Grenoble

Republic of Ireland don miss di chance to automatically qualify for di 2027 Women’s World Cup as dem lose 1-0 to France for Grenoble. Na winner takes all final qualifier wey France win.

Manchester United striker Melvine Malard score di winning goal for 40 minutes. Na acrobatic effort from a short corner routine wey bounce off di crossbar before enter net.

Thiniba Samoura bin see red card after two yellow card offences. But Republic of Ireland no fit use dia numerical advantage as France hold on for di win wey help dem top di group and reach dia sixth World Cup.

Carla Ward side finish third for Group A2 after Netherlands win over Poland. But dem still fit reach next year tournament for Brazil as dem go be seeded for autumn play-offs. Di draw go happen on 18 June.

France dominate di match from di start for Grenoble. Courtney Brosnan bin come into action early to stop Grace Geyoro and Melvine Malard. Brosnan palm away a fierce strike from di French captain before denying Malard from a tight angle.

Republic of Ireland resistance bin break five minutes before half-time through Malard sumptuous acrobatic effort wey bounce in off di crossbar after ball fall fortuitously for her for di box.

Ward side bin improve well well after di break with Marissa Sheva and Anna Patten forcing saves from Constance Picaud. Dia hopes of fight back bin boost further when Samoura see red for hauling down Emily Murphy as she bin bursting through on goal.

But substitute Abbie Larkin squander a huge chance to draw di Irish level soon after as she shoot straight at Picaud from point-blank range. France hold on for a narrow and important victory.

E bin always require a near perfect performance from Republic of Ireland to spring another surprise and beat France for Grenoble. E ultimately prove a step too far.

With automatic qualification up for grabs, Les Bleues, wey last lose on home soil two years ago against England, bin on top from di start and eventually get di breakthrough dem deserve through a bit of quality from Malard. She also net twice when France beat di Irish for Tallaght for March.

Di Irish, as dem don do throughout di campaign, bin defensively solid for di most part, but surprisingly passive going di other way, particularly for di first half.

Ward half-time team talk spark her side into life for di second half. Dem go rue di fact say two big chances fall to unlikely goalscorers for di form of Sheva and Patten and say Larkin no fit keep her composure to finish past Picaud.

Netherlands win over Poland condemn Ward side to third place for di group. But na dia target from di start of di campaign and dem perform admirably as di first promoted side to avoid relegation and win three games for League A.

With a seeded play-off to come, dem still get a realistic chance of reaching back-to-back World Cups. Given dia displays for dis tough group, dem go be di side nobody want to face when di draw happen later dis month.
